Erindale is a highly sought-after historic enclave within Mississauga, Canada's seventh-largest city. Straddling the gorgeous Credit River valley, Erindale, Mississauga offers an attractive blend of quiet residential streets, modern condominiums, and natural scenery. The neighborhood is particularly renowned for its proximity to the University of Toronto Mississauga (UTM) campus, making it an enduring favorite for families, working professionals, and students seeking a balance of nature and urban access.
A lifestyle rooted in nature. The heart of the community's outdoor appeal lies in Erindale Park, which features the scenic Culham Trail and extensive riverside green space along the Credit River valley. Convenient local shopping and dining. Everyday errands are easily managed at the Dundas & Erindale plaza, anchored by a local FreshCo grocery store. The community is also home to long-standing local favorites like the Erindale Family Restaurant. For a broader retail experience, residents are only a short drive away from Square One Shopping Centre and the bustling commercial hub of Central Erin Mills.
Excellent schools and transit connections. Education is a major draw for families in this neighborhood, with Erindale Secondary School offering the prestigious International Baccalaureate programme, alongside the highly regarded Woodlands School. Commuters benefit from the nearby Erindale GO station on the Milton line, providing direct access to downtown Toronto, while drivers have convenient access to major arteries including Highway 403 and Highway 401.
